🎤 Scarlett Johansson vs. OpenAI: The Voice Controversy Unfolds
In a dramatic turn of events, Hollywood star Scarlett Johansson has accused OpenAI of creating a ChatGPT voice called \"Sky\" that sounds \"eerily similar\" to hers 😲. This comes after she reportedly declined an offer to voice the AI assistant herself.
Johansson expressed her shock and anger upon hearing the demo. \"When I heard the released demo, I was shocked, angered, and in disbelief that Mr. Altman would pursue a voice that sounded so eerily similar to mine that my closest friends and news outlets could not tell the difference,\" she said.
OpenAI's Response 🧐
OpenAI CEO Sam Altman responded by stating that Sky's voice was not an imitation of Johansson's but belonged to a different professional actress. \"The voice of Sky is not Scarlett Johansson's, and it was never intended to resemble hers,\" Altman said. \"We cast the voice actor behind Sky's voice before any outreach to Ms. Johansson.\"
Out of respect for the actress, OpenAI has paused the use of Sky's voice in their products. \"We are sorry to Ms. Johansson that we didn't communicate better,\" Altman added.
Art Imitating Life? 🎬
Adding fuel to the fire, Johansson pointed out that Altman had tweeted a reference to \"Her,\" the 2013 film where she voices an AI assistant. This led her to believe that the similarity was intentional. \"He insinuated that the similarity was intentional,\" she remarked.
What's Next? 🔮
Johansson has hired legal counsel to investigate the creation process of the \"Sky\" voice. As AI technology continues to evolve, this incident raises questions about voice likeness rights and the ethical implications of AI-generated content.
A New Era of AI Voices 🗣️
OpenAI's latest model, GPT-4o (short for \"omni\"), showcases real-time reasoning across text, audio, and video. While it's not widely available yet, its demos have sparked both fascination and concern. Some have noted that the AI's interactions feel strangely human and even flirtatious.
